Assuming you have enough space to lie down, stand up and move your arms and legs freely, you can have a great cardio workout in almost any space. The trick is to discipline yourself to not allow long periods of rest between exercises that will allow you heart rate to drop back down. Even actions as simple as sitting on the floor and standing quickly, safely though, can do the trick.

Here are just some small space exercises that can be employed. Jumping Jacks Ski strides Torso twists Torso twist to toes Running in place High knees. Bend and Thrusts Push ups Mt. Climbers Leg Lifts Crunches Alt Crunches Bicycling on back Flutter kicks Flutter side kicks Dophin raises. Pick seven and do several reps, of each, very brief pauses, between, and focus on form and a steady pace.Just drink enough water.
